When people are dirty, they take a bath or a shower. Animals don’t have soap (肥皂), but they do keep themselves clean. Many animals with hair, such as dogs and cats, keep themselves clean by licking (舔) their hair. They also use their teeth to pull out small dirty things from their hair. When they lick their hair, it is almost as if they are using a wet brush to clean themselves.
Birds take baths to stay clean. First, they walk through water that is not deep. Next, they beat their wings to dry themselves. Birds also take sand baths on the ground. It is thought that they do this to drive away parasites (寄生虫).
Even sh need cleaning. Fish have very little parasites that live in their mouths. Some sh live by eating these parasites of other sh. Such sh are called “cleaner sh”. Larger sh will open their mouths so that the cleaner sh can get in to clean.
Some animals that live in groups clean each other, such as monkeys. They often clean one another. One monkey may clean an area that the other monkey can’t reach. How interesting it is!

In many places, people build roads through animals’ habitats (栖息地). All day long, cars and trucks pass by. The animals can’t always stay away from the road. They may need to cross it to get their food and water. The road is dangerous. If a car hits an animal, the animal would be badly hurt or even killed. The people in the car would get hurt, too. Animals need a way to get around their habitat without having to walk across the road. But how
Some people have thought of a solution (方法). They build wildlife corridors (走廊) that let animals cross roads safely. Some wildlife corridors are bridges that go over roads. People plant trees and grass on these bridges so they look like the natural habitat. Other wildlife corridors are tunnels (隧道) that go under the roads. Animals can look through them and see the habitat on the other side.
Different animals like to use different kinds of corridors. Some animals, such as moose and deer, like open spaces. They like bridge corridors better. Other animals, like black bears, like the tunnel corridors.
Wildlife corridors help animals get around their habitats to find food. They also keep people from getting into dangerous accidents. They are a great way for animals and people to live in the same area safely.

For thousands of years, people have lived with dogs. Ancient paintings on the walls of caves show people living with dogs. In each county, dogs come in a wide variety of shapes and sizes.
The largest dog in the world was Zorba, a huge mastiff (獒,大驯犬) that passed away in 1990. When Zorba was seven years old in 1989, he was 94 centimeters (37 inches) tall. In other words, Zorba was more than half as tall as an adult man. At his largest, Zorba weighed more than a heavyweight boxer at 156 kilograms (343 pounds).
In comparison, the smallest dog ever was a Yorkshire terrier named Sylvia from England. This dog only the size of a matchbox, measuring just over six centimeters (2.5 inches) tall and just under nine centimeters (3.5 inches) from nose to tail. The dog weighed about half as much as this book, and even a young child could easily pick it up with one hand. It died in 1945 when it was only two years old.
Some dogs are remarkable, not for their size, but for their brain. One incredible dog is Endal, the companion of a man named Allen Parton, who has used a wheelchair since a car accident in 1991.
In 2001, Parson was hit by a car, while crossing a road with Endal, and thrown out of his chair. Endal quickly moved Parton into the recovery position, covered him with a blanket, and pushed his mobile phone close enough for him to reach. Then, once he saw that Parton was all right, Endal ran back and forth to a nearby hotel, barking until people came out to help.
Endal was rewarded for his bravery by being awarded a medal, and he has been the subject of a number of TV documentaries.
